The 2019 Spikers’ Turf Reinforced Conference was the thirteenth conference of the Spikers' Turf. The tournament began on May 19, 2019[1] at the Paco Arena.[2]

Format

Preliminary round
  • The preliminary round was a single round-robin tournament, with each team playing one match against all other teams for a total of 11 matches.
  • The top four teams advanced to the semifinals while the bottom eight were eliminated.
Semifinals
  • The semifinals featured best-of-three series.
  • The match-ups were as follows:
    • SF1: #1 vs. #4
    • SF2: #2 vs. #3
  • The winners advanced to the championship while the losers would play in the third-place series.
Finals
  • The championship and third-place series were best-of-three series.
  • The match-ups were as follows:
    • Championship: Semifinal round winners
    • Third-place series: Semifinal round losers
Remove ads

Pool standing procedure

  • First, teams are ranked by the number of matches won.
  • If the number of matches won is tied, the tied teams are then ranked by match points, wherein:
    • Match won 3–0 or 3–1: 3 match points for the winner, 0 match points for the loser.
    • Match won 3–2: 2 match points for the winner, 1 match point for the loser.
  • In case of any further ties, the following criteria shall be used:
    • Set ratio: the number of sets won divided by number of sets lost.
    • Point ratio: number of points scored divided by number of points allowed.
    • Head-to-head standings: any remaining tied teams are ranked based on the results of head-to-head matches involving the teams in question.

2019 Reinforced Conference champions
Cignal HD Spikers
Ysrael Marasigan (c), Rex Intal, Karl Baysa, Owen Suarez, Peter Torres, Edmar Bonono, Lorenzo Capate Jr., Jude Garcia, Vince Mangulabnan, Wendel Miguel, Angelino Pertierra, Manuel Sumanguid III, John Paul Bugaoan, Marck Espejo – Head coach: Dexter Clamor
